How many Degrees did Frederick Douglass attain?

Frederick Douglass did not formally attain any academic degrees, as he was largely self-educated. Born into slavery, he learned to read and write on his own and became a prominent abolitionist, orator, and writer. His lack of formal education did not hinder his intellectual achievements and contributions to society. Douglass received several honorary degrees later in life in recognition of his work and impact.

What is the lowest possible temperature on the Celsius scale on the kelvin scale?

In theory it is 0 Kelvin. However, that temperature is physically impossible to attain. The current (2017) world record, set in 1999, stands at 100 picokelvins (pK), or 0.000 000 000 1 of a kelvin.

Why molecules of a substance in a gaseous state attain free movement?

Different atoms and molecules have different degrees of attraction for other atoms and molecules in their vicinity. They also have different degrees of kinetic energy, which is measured by temperature. In other words, hot atoms and molecules have faster motion or vibration than cold ones. If the kinetic energy exceeds the attraction, the molecule or atom flies off on its own. If the attraction exceeds the kinetic energy, the molecule or atom remains glued in place.
